2012 CLP to RSD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the CLP to RSD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on August 8, valuing the pair at 0.2025.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 2, dropping to 0.1567.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0457 RSD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.1626 to the December average rate of 0.1810, the exchange rate registered a net change of 11.28%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 0.2025 was up 19.49% compared to the 2011 peak of 0.1694,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 0.1733, compared to 0.1882 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.0149 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 0.1733
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 0.1882

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2012 was July, with a trading range of 0.0164 RSD (High: 0.1989 / Low: 0.1825). On the other end, June was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0041 RSD (High: 0.1845 / Low: 0.1804).

July Spread (Volatile) ±0.0164
June Spread (Stable) ±0.0041

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.1657 0.1567 0.1626
February 0.1718 0.1645 0.1699
March 0.1754 0.1708 0.1726
April 0.1759 0.1708 0.1742
May 0.1824 0.1743 0.1780
June 0.1845 0.1804 0.1824
July 0.1989 0.1825 0.1928
August 0.2025 0.1944 0.1977
September 0.1958 0.1870 0.1904
October 0.1892 0.1806 0.1844
November 0.1852 0.1796 0.1830
December 0.1851 0.1781 0.1810
